Former J.Crew boss Mickey Drexler is increasing the property in Miami Seaside
Former J.Crew boss Mickey Drexler, who spent over $ 26 million on adjoining waterfront properties on one of Miami Beach’s most exclusive streets in 2017, is expanding again and snapping, according to people familiar with the deal , a neighbor’s property for $ 16.5 million.
The purchase expands Mr. Drexler’s presence on affluent North Bay Road to approximately 1.3 acres across three lots in Biscayne Bay, according to property records. The result is one of the largest properties on a strip known for its business titans and celebrities.
Last year, Jonathan Oringer, founder and CEO of Shutterstock, and his wife Talia Oringer bought a house there for around $ 42 million, real estate data shows. Barry Gibb, a founding member of Bee Gees, also owns a home on North Bay Road, according to real estate records, and retired NBA star Dwyane Wade recently sold his home on North Bay Road for $ 22 million.
Mr. Drexler has been assembling the property on North Bay Road for several years. In 2017, he spent $ 12.85 million buying a mansion property from fashion designer Calvin Klein, real estate records show. At the time of sale, the Mediterranean-style home was wrapped around a courtyard and docked on Biscayne Bay.
